Machine Learning Engineer

Machine Learning Engineer

London Full-Time 43200 - 72000 £ / year (est.) No home office possible
H

At a Glance

  • Tasks: Develop cutting-edge machine learning models for game development and automation.
  • Company: Epic Games creates award-winning games and innovative engine technology globally.
  • Benefits: Enjoy comprehensive benefits, including health insurance, mental well-being support, and a cycle to work scheme.
  • Why this job: Join a creative team pushing the boundaries of gaming technology and making a real impact.
  • Qualifications: PhD in Computer Science or 3+ years of experience in machine learning and deep learning.
  • Other info: Epic values diversity and inclusivity, fostering a welcoming work culture.

The predicted salary is between 43200 - 72000 £ per year.

WHAT MAKES US EPIC?

At the core of Epic’s success are talented, passionate people. Epic prides itself on creating a collaborative, welcoming, and creative environment. Whether it’s building award-winning games or crafting engine technology that enables others to make visually stunning interactive experiences, we’re always innovating.

Being Epic means being a part of a team that continually strives to do right by our community and users. We’re constantly innovating to raise the bar of engine and game development.

ENGINEERING – GAMES

What We Do

Unreal projects have been leading the pack of real-time entertainment with our constantly growing team of engineering experts. We’re always improving on the tools and technology that empower content developers worldwide.

What You\’ll Do

You will work with our team of applied research engineers at the intersection of computer vision, natural language processing and machine learning to create state-of-the-art tools to support game developers in our ecosystem, as well as automation of a number key areas, including localization, moderation, and testing. You will be responsible for the design, implementation and deployment of production-ready machine learning models that can be integrated in our ecosystem, with various applications (e.g. content generation, development assistants, etc.).

In this role, you will

  • Create and deliver production-ready, scalable and high-quality machine learning models and associated algorithms
  • Critically assess the effectiveness of such models and make recommendations for the ongoing roadmap
  • Methodically understand and assess the effectiveness of new data channels and support collection/creation of new ones

What we\’re looking for

  • PhD in Computer Science, Mathematics or related field, or 3+ years of relevant industry experience
  • Experience creating / applying machine learning algorithms for vision (2D or 3D) or language problems and deploying them as production-level systems
  • Expert, hands-on knowledge of:
    • Deep learning, incl. but not limited to applications in the gaming industry
    • Foundational models and vision and/or language, incl. local deployment of open models, continued training and fine-tuning cloud and local models
    • Python and associated ML tools/frameworks (numpy, scipy, sklearn, pytorch)
  • Experience with working collaboratively with other developers, following a flexible/agile/lean approach

EPIC JOB + EPIC BENEFITS = EPIC LIFE

We pay 100% for benefits except for PMI (for dependents). Our current benefits package includes pension, private medical insurance, health care cash plan, dental insurance, disability and life insurance, critical illness, cycle to work scheme, flu shots, health checks, and meals. We also offer a robust mental well-being program through Modern Health, which provides free therapy and coaching for employees & dependents.

ABOUT US

Epic Games spans across 25 countries with 46 studios and 4,500+ employees globally. For over 25 years, we\’ve been making award-winning games and engine technology that empowers others to make visually stunning games and 3D content that bring environments to life like never before. Epic\’s award-winning Unreal Engine technology not only provides game developers the ability to build high-fidelity, interactive experiences for PC, console, mobile, and VR, it is also a tool being embraced by content creators across a variety of industries such as media and entertainment, automotive, and architectural design. As we continue to build our Engine technology and develop remarkable games, we strive to build teams of world-class talent.

Like what you hear? Come be a part of something Epic!

Epic Games deeply values diverse teams and an inclusive work culture, and we are proud to be an Equal Opportunity employer. Learn more about our Equal Employment Opportunity (EEO) Policy here .

Note to Recruitment Agencies: Epic does not accept any unsolicited resumes or approaches from any unauthorized third party (including recruitment or placement agencies) (i.e., a third party with whom we do not have a negotiated and validly executed agreement). We will not pay any fees to any unauthorized third party. Further details on these matters can be found here .

#J-18808-Ljbffr

Machine Learning Engineer employer: Houston Texans

Epic Games is an exceptional employer that fosters a collaborative and innovative work culture, perfect for Machine Learning Engineers looking to make a significant impact in the gaming industry. With comprehensive benefits including 100% coverage for health insurance and a strong focus on employee well-being, Epic supports personal and professional growth while working on cutting-edge technology that empowers developers worldwide. Join a diverse team dedicated to pushing the boundaries of game development in a creative environment that values your contributions.
H

Contact Detail:

Houston Texans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Machine Learning Engineer

✨Tip Number 1

Familiarise yourself with the latest advancements in machine learning, particularly in computer vision and natural language processing. Being well-versed in current trends and technologies will help you stand out during discussions with our team.

✨Tip Number 2

Engage with the gaming community and showcase your projects on platforms like GitHub or personal blogs. This not only demonstrates your skills but also shows your passion for the industry, which aligns with our collaborative culture.

✨Tip Number 3

Network with professionals in the field by attending relevant conferences or meetups. Building connections can provide insights into our work environment and may even lead to referrals within our team.

✨Tip Number 4

Prepare to discuss your experience with deploying machine learning models in production settings. Be ready to share specific examples of challenges you've faced and how you overcame them, as this will resonate with our focus on practical applications.

We think you need these skills to ace Machine Learning Engineer

Machine Learning Algorithms
Deep Learning
Computer Vision
Natural Language Processing
Python Programming
PyTorch
Numpy
Scipy
Scikit-learn
Model Deployment
Data Collection and Creation
Agile Methodologies
Collaboration Skills
Problem-Solving Skills
Critical Thinking

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your relevant experience in machine learning, particularly in computer vision and natural language processing. Include specific projects or roles where you've applied deep learning techniques, especially in the gaming industry.

Craft a Compelling Cover Letter: In your cover letter, express your passion for game development and how your skills align with Epic's mission. Mention any collaborative projects you've worked on and how you can contribute to their innovative environment.

Showcase Your Technical Skills: Clearly outline your expertise in Python and machine learning frameworks like PyTorch, as well as your experience with deploying production-level systems. Provide examples of algorithms you've created or improved, especially those relevant to gaming applications.

Highlight Your Research Experience: If you have a PhD or relevant industry experience, detail your research work related to machine learning models. Discuss any publications or presentations that demonstrate your knowledge and contributions to the field.

How to prepare for a job interview at Houston Texans

✨Showcase Your Technical Skills

Be prepared to discuss your experience with machine learning algorithms, especially in computer vision and natural language processing. Bring examples of projects where you've successfully implemented these technologies, and be ready to explain your thought process and the challenges you faced.

✨Understand Epic's Culture

Familiarise yourself with Epic Games' collaborative and innovative environment. Highlight how your values align with theirs, and be ready to discuss how you can contribute to their mission of empowering game developers and enhancing user experiences.

✨Prepare for Problem-Solving Questions

Expect technical questions that assess your problem-solving abilities. Practice explaining your approach to designing and deploying machine learning models, and be ready to tackle hypothetical scenarios related to game development and automation.

✨Demonstrate Team Collaboration

Since the role involves working closely with other developers, be prepared to discuss your experience in collaborative environments. Share examples of how you've successfully worked in agile teams, and emphasise your ability to adapt and communicate effectively with colleagues.

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

H
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>